1. A dart is loaded into a spring-loaded toy dart gun by pushing the spring in by a
    distance d. For the next loading, the spring is compressed a distance d/3. How much
    work is required to load the second dart compared to that required to load the first?

nine times as much

three times as much

the same

one-third as much

one-ninth as much

4. A competitive diver leaves the diving board and falls toward the water with her body
    straight and rotating slowly. She pulls her arms and legs into a tight tuck position.
    What happens to her angular speed?

A. It increases.

It decreases.

It stays the same.

It is impossible to determine.

1)

Because the work done in compressing a spring is proportional to the square of the compression distance x,

W1 = 1/2 k d^2

W2 = 1/2 k ( d/3)^2

= W1/9

so answer is one-ninth as much

4)

The diver is an isolated system, so the product Iω remains constant. Because her moment of inertia decreases, her angular speed increases.
